Fluorescence detection of some nitrosoamines in high-performance liquid chromatography after post-column reaction
Journal of Chromatography
|January 16, 1987
Abstract:
A selective fluorescence detection method for the determination of some N-nitrosoamines after post-column reaction has been developed for reversed-phase liquid chromatography. The N-nitroso compounds are analyzed by allowing their hydrolysis products to react with the oxidizing species Ce4+ to produce the fluorescent ion Ce3+. The detection limit for this method is at the ppb (the American billion, 10(9)) level with a linear dynamic range of 2-3 orders of magnitude.
